Born in New South Wales, Rogers is an attacking left-arm spinner who has the ability to maintain a strict control over line and length. He made his debut on Scotland's short tour of Bangladesh in late 2006 and had been earmarked as a key player for their World Cricket League campaign in Kenya. However, during the preceding ICC Tri-series in Mombasa he contracted typhoid which forced him to return home early although the selectors kept faith with him for their World Cup squad.
